O'Day 32 Sailboat
Hard bilges, beaminess, and a favorable ballast to-displacement ratio contribute to the stability of The O'Day 32. She is also equipped with a lightning ground. Her rigging has been swagged instead of nicropressed. Her mast is stepped on the keel. Her hull and keel are of one-piece construction.
